Check the Licence Before the Offer
A UK-facing casino should display clear licensing information and identify the company responsible for operating the platform. A valid licence indicates that the operator must meet regulatory expectations covering fairness, customer funds, complaints, advertising, and responsible gambling controls. Do not rely solely on a logo in the website footer. Verify the operator’s details through the relevant regulator’s public register where possible.
Reliable sites normally provide their legal name, registered address, terms and conditions, privacy policy, and age-verification information. Missing or inconsistent details are warning signs, particularly when the casino promotes large bonuses but gives little information about its obligations.
Compare Bonuses by Their Real Value
A promotional offer can be useful, but its headline amount rarely tells the whole story. Read the qualifying deposit, wagering requirement, maximum bonus conversion, eligible games, expiry period, and withdrawal restrictions before accepting it. Some promotions also impose maximum bet limits or exclude certain payment methods.
| Bonus detail | Why it matters | What to check |
|---|---|---|
| Wagering requirement | Determines how many times qualifying funds must be played | Whether it applies to the deposit, bonus, or both |
| Game contribution | Shows which games count toward completion | Different percentages for slots, table games, and live casino |
| Expiry period | Limits the time available to meet conditions | Exact date or number of days |
| Maximum stake | Can affect eligibility if exceeded | Bet limits during bonus play |
| Withdrawal rules | May restrict cashing out promotional balances | Maximum winnings, verification, and excluded funds |
In many cases, a smaller promotion with transparent conditions is more valuable than an unusually large offer with restrictive rules. Compare the total cost of qualifying rather than choosing by percentage or cash value alone.
Assess Games, Software, and Fairness
A strong casino should offer a balanced selection from established software providers, including slots, jackpots, table games, and live dealer titles where available. Game pages should show rules, paylines, return-to-player information, and volatility indicators when supplied by the developer. These details do not guarantee a result, but they make informed selection possible.
Random number generators and live games should be tested or audited by recognised independent organisations. Look for evidence of certification rather than vague claims about fairness. Remember that return-to-player figures describe long-term statistical performance, not a promise for an individual session. Progressive jackpots can also have different contribution structures and maximum prize conditions.

Evaluate Payments and Withdrawals
Payment quality is a practical test of an operator’s credibility. Check whether the casino supports familiar methods such as cards, bank transfers, or recognised e-wallets, and compare minimum deposits, fees, processing times, and transaction limits. A deposit that is instant does not mean a withdrawal will be equally fast.
Withdrawal requests may require identity, address, and payment verification. This is normal under anti-money-laundering rules, but the process should be explained clearly. Operators that repeatedly reverse withdrawals, add unexpected fees, or change requirements without explanation deserve caution. Read the cashier terms before depositing, especially if you intend to withdraw quickly.
Use Responsible Gambling as a Selection Test
Responsible gambling tools should be easy to find and simple to activate. Useful controls include deposit limits, loss limits, session reminders, temporary time-outs, reality checks, and self-exclusion. A trustworthy casino should also provide information about independent support services without making risky play appear normal or unlimited.
